The 'Parliament of Barbados' is the supreme
legislative institution of the country of
Barbados. The Parliament of Barbados is
bicameral between the
Senate ("
Upper House") and
House of Assembly ("
Lower House"). ''Definition:'' According to section 5 of the
Constitution of Barbados the Parliament of Barbados is composed of three elements.
★ the Sovereign (currently
Queen Elizabeth II, represented by
Governor-General Sir Clifford Husbands),
★ the
Senate, and
★ the
House of Assembly.
